Susan was supposed to use 5/4 of a cup of butter
ElenaW [278]

Answer:

a.\ \dfrac{3}{5}

Step-by-step explanation:

We can see the fractions \frac{5}{4} and \frac{3}{4} of cups.

It can be seen that denominator has 4 i.e. the fraction \frac{1}{4}.

Let us suppose, a unit is equal to \frac{1}4 of a cup.

Susan was supposed to use \frac{5}{4} of a cup.

i.e. 5 units of butter was to be used.

But, actual recipe has only 3 units of butter.

\text{Fraction of butter used} = \dfrac{\text{Units of butter used}}{\text{Unit of butter Susan was supposed to use}}

a. \text{Fraction of butter used} = \dfrac{3}{5}

Alternatively, we could have directly divided the given fractions:

\dfrac{\dfrac{3}{4}}{\dfrac{5}{4}} = \dfrac{3}{5}

What is (1/0)^2+(22/3)
Sergio [31]

(1/0)^2+(22/3)


You can't divide anything by 0, so the first part (1/0)^2 is undefined, which makes the entire expression undefined.
